Kartal Tibet

Biography

Kartal Tibet (27 March 1939, Ankara - 1 July 2021) was a Turkish actor, director, screenwriter and producer.

He took part in nearly two hundred movies and TV series as actor, director and screenwriter. In cinema, he first played the lead role in the comic book adaptations Karaoğlan and Tarkan adventure films. In the 1970s, he shared the lead roles with many actors including Hülya Koçyiğit, Türkan Şoray, Fatma Girik, Hale Soygazi and Filiz Akın. Tibet made his directorial debut in 1977 with Tosun Pasha and directed 56 films, more than twenty of which starred Kemal Sunal. He also wrote the screenplays for films such as Davaro, Şendul Şaban and Şabaniye.

He was awarded the Golden Orange Film Festival Lifetime Honor Award in 2002 and the Yıldırım Önal Memorial Award in 2006 for his contributions to Turkish cinema. He died on July 1, 2021 in Istanbul at the age of 82.
